LED lamp control system based on PLC
Technical Field
The invention relates to a PLC-based LED lamp control system.
Background
When a driver passes through a crossroad, the driver needs to pay attention to safety all the time, particularly whether pedestrians and/or non-motor vehicles exist on a zebra crossing or not, when a traffic light of a lane where the driver is located turns green, if the pedestrians and/or the non-motor vehicles exist on the zebra crossing, accidents are easily caused, as the sight of the driver is blocked by vehicles on adjacent lanes sometimes, the pedestrians and/or the non-motor vehicles on the zebra crossing can not be found in time, and therefore the driver needs to be reminded to pay attention to the pedestrians and/or the non-motor vehicles on the zebra crossing when the traffic light of the lane where the driver is located turns green.
Disclosure of Invention
The invention aims to provide an LED lamp control system based on a PLC, which comprises a zebra crossing pedestrian lighting reminding module consisting of a plurality of LED lamps and a zebra crossing non-motor vehicle lighting reminding module consisting of a plurality of LED lamps.
In order to achieve the purpose, the technical scheme of the invention is to design an LED lamp control system based on a PLC, which comprises traffic lights at an intersection, wherein the traffic lights are used for controlling the vehicles of a certain main road to pass through, the main road consists of a plurality of lanes, the main road is provided with zebra stripes at the intersection, and the zebra stripes cross the lanes;
the lanes are also respectively provided with at the crossroad: the system comprises a pedestrian light-emitting reminding module arranged on a zebra crossing consisting of a plurality of LED lamps, and a non-motor vehicle light-emitting reminding module arranged on the zebra crossing consisting of a plurality of LED lamps; the pedestrian luminous reminding module and the non-motor vehicle luminous reminding module are positioned above the corresponding lanes; the pedestrian light-emitting reminding module on each zebra crossing and the non-motor vehicle light-emitting reminding module on each zebra crossing are controlled by the same PLC to emit light;
the crossroad is also provided with: a monitoring device for monitoring the zebra crossing; the monitoring device monitors the state of the zebra crossing when the traffic light is green, and identifies pedestrians and non-motor vehicles on the zebra crossing; when the red and green light is green and the pedestrian on the zebra crossing is identified, the monitoring device continuously sends a prompting signal that the pedestrian is on the zebra crossing to the PLC; when the red and green light is a green light and the fact that the non-motor vehicle is on the zebra crossing is identified, the monitoring device continuously sends a reminding signal that the non-motor vehicle is on the zebra crossing to the PLC;
when the PLC receives a pedestrian reminding signal of each zebra crossing, the PLC controls the light-emitting reminding module of each zebra crossing to emit light, and the light-emitting reminding module of each zebra crossing keeps flashing and emitting light during the continuous period of the pedestrian reminding signal of each zebra crossing;
when the PLC receives that the zebra crossing has the non-motor vehicle reminding signal, the PLC controls the non-motor vehicle luminous reminding module on each zebra crossing to emit light, and the non-motor vehicle luminous reminding module on each zebra crossing keeps flickering and emitting light during the time that the non-motor vehicle reminding signal is on the zebra crossing.
Preferably, the LED lamps forming the zebra crossing comprise a pedestrian light-emitting reminding module which emits yellow light when emitting light.
Preferably, a plurality of LED lamps forming the zebra crossing with the non-motor vehicle luminous reminding module emit yellow light when emitting light.
Preferably, the zebra crossing is composed of a plurality of LED lamps of a pedestrian lighting reminding module, and the LED lamps form a pedestrian pattern.
Preferably, the zebra crossing is composed of a plurality of LED lamps of the non-motor vehicle luminous reminding module, and the LED lamps form a non-motor vehicle pattern.
